Position: Product Manager (Smart Appliance/ Hardware/Network)
Job Overview:
This position will be part of QNAP INC and IEI Technology USA Corporation Group’s new business start-up division (Business Unit). It will have a significant role in analyzing group resources, conducting independent analyses, and maximizing their potential to drive business breakthroughs and make a positive impact in the market through the creation and implementation of new products.
We are seeking a passionate and driven Product Manager to join our new team which will form as a new division for the QNAP/IEI Group. As a Product Manager, you will be making important business decisions and collaborating in a team to create a new product. While relevant experience is a plus, it is not a mandatory requirement.
This position will be focusing on hardware, network appliances, and smart devices. Candidates who exhibit the following qualities and experiences will be a plus:
1. Proficiency and passion for understanding computer system specifications.
2. Hands-on experience and fervor for computer systems, embedded systems, network equipment, smart appliances, computer assembly, CPUs, graphics cards, and various computer peripherals.
3. A penchant for exploration and keen observation of inconveniences and pain points across different domains.
4. Enthusiasm for exploring innovative technological solutions that enhance convenience and elevate efficiency in daily life.
5. Enjoyment of shopping, eagerness to experiment with new technology products, and the willingness of hands-on in unboxing, assembling, and setup.
6. With personal insights into hardware and smart device sales trends within different markets or specific domains. Ability to decipher why a product is popular and the potential challenges behind its success.
7. Experience or enthusiasm for TCP/IP network architecture and applications, along with an understanding of cloud services.
8. Passionate about user experiences, particularly in software-hardware integration and the entire process of device setup, installation, and usage.
Responsibilities:
1. Product Lifecycle Management:
– Manage the entire product lifecycle from concept to end-of-life.
– Work independently in the startup phase and collaborate with a virtual team to identify startup ideas and product concepts.
– Scale the team as the product direction becomes clear, fostering collaborative efforts.
2. Product Specification:
– Seek breakthroughs through methods like market and competitor analysis.
– Collaborate with relevant stakeholders to gather market demands and define product specifications.
– Maintain a deep understanding of industry trends and competitor products.
3. Market Opportunity Analysis:
– Conduct comprehensive market research to identify trends, opportunities, and potential threats.
– Analyze market data and customer insights to make data-driven decisions.
– Identify and quantify market segments and target customers.
4. Return on Investment (ROI) Analysis:
– Develop financial models to assess the potential ROI of new product initiatives.
– Monitor product performance metrics and optimize ROI and profitability.
– Provide strategic recommendations to senior management based on ROI evaluations.
5. Go-to-Market Strategy:
– Collaborate with sales and marketing teams to develop effective go-to-market strategies.
– Create and execute product launch plans, ensuring all stakeholders are aligned and prepared.
– Provide sales support resources and training to facilitate successful product launches.
6. Cost Estimation and Budget Planning:
– Simulate the Bill of Materials (BOM) cost and forecast monthly profit and loss to gain a comprehensive view of total investment and budget planning.
7. Leveraging Internal Resources:
– Research and utilize internal company resources, including engineering capabilities, hardware and software design, and existing software assets, to accelerate the execution and success of new startups.
– Commit 40% of your time and effort to participate in company activities to gain deep and rapid understanding of resources, interact with customers and internal functional teams. These activities may include participating in trade shows, new product launches, promotional videos, tutorials, etc., but the plan will be dynamic and subject to the defined startup topic.
8. Market Expansion and New Product Lines:
– Actively explore opportunities to expand the total addressable market (TAM) and consider launching associated new product lines to cater to different customer needs.
9. Core Marketing Content Writing:
– Compose core messaging for future marketing materials, including web page content, flyers, presentation slides, print magazine ads, and social media promotions. Crafting these key messages is essential to attract potential customers, highlight product value and advantages, and enhance brand image.
